ANNUAL ANIMAL ESSAY CONTEST

2008 - Essays

The following are some of the winning essays, click on the student names to read their essays.

Third Grade
Essay Topic: If animals could talk, what would they say?

bullet First Place - Brianna Sprouse, Blanton Elementary, Arlington ISD
bullet Second Place - Isabell Taylor, Blanton Elementary, Arlington ISD
bullet Third Place - Ashley Flores, Blanton Elementary, Arlington ISD

Fourth Grade
Essay Topic: What feelings do you think animals have?

bullet First Place - Daniel Cain, Sherrod Elementary, Arlington ISD
bullet Second Place - Christina Saladin, Bryant Elementary, Arlington ISD
bullet Third Place - Tony Lopez, Wood Elementary, Arlington ISD

Fifth Grade
Essay Topic: What are some ways to make life better for animals in your community?

bullet First Place - Dusty Lynn Shipley, Dunn Elementary, Arlington ISD
bullet Second Place - Derek Hegna, Ashworth Elementary, Arlington ISD
bullet Third Place - Julie Nguyen, Williams Elementary, Arlington ISD

Sixth Grade
Essay Topic: How do animals benefit us in our daily lives?

bullet First Place - Kami Stockett, James Arthur Elementary, Kennedale ISD
bullet Second Place - Laura Calzada, Amos Elementary, Arlington ISD
bullet Third Place - Michael Lopez, Wood Elementary, Arlington ISD
